A family-of-seven have been dealt fresh tragedy after their home was ravaged by fire – their second house to be burned down in four months.
The out-of-control blaze engulfed the home in Alexandra Hills, east of Brisbane, about 11.30 pm on Tuesday, forcing the family to flee.
The home was burned to a blackened shell, but the single mother, her five children – including one in a wheelchair – and another adult escaped injury.
Neighbours reported hearing explosions and screams for help as the fire took grip, according to 9 News.
‘They were horrific screams… Pretty much the loudest I’ve ever heard someone scream,’ neighbour Tarlia Klein said.
A woman aged in her 20s and a man in his 30s were taken to hospital for smoke inhalation.
